概括
研究人员使用光遗传学来阻止缺乏Sapap3基因的小鼠过度理. 这种方法恢复了行为抑制,并显示出治疗神经精神疾病中重复性行为的前景.

背景情况:
- 前前电路功能障碍与具有重复行为的神经精神障碍有关.
- 在小鼠中,Sapap3基因被删除会导致过度理,模拟强迫行为.
研究的目的:
- 在小鼠模型中开发一种光遗传学方法来抑制强迫性,重复性行为.
- 为了研究Sapap3缺陷小鼠行为缺陷背后的神经机制.
主要方法:
- 利用延迟调节任务来评估突变小鼠的行为反应抑制.
- 采用侧面轨道前皮层和条纹终端的专注光遗传刺激.
- 检查了条状投影神经元活动和快速升的神经元微电路.
主要成果:
- 缺乏Sapap3的小鼠在行为反应抑制方面表现出缺陷.
- 这些缺陷与状神经元活动下调受损相关.
- 光遗传刺激成功地恢复了行为抑制和神经活动的正常化.
结论:
- 在前直回路中的光遗传干预可以有效地减少重复性行为.
- 这项研究突出了针对强迫性行为特征的疾病的向疗法的潜力.

Operant Conditioning Intervention
Operant conditioning serves as a foundational principle in therapeutic interventions aimed at modifying maladaptive behaviors. Central to this approach is the notion that behaviors, both adaptive and maladaptive, are learned through reinforcement. By analyzing the environmental factors that reinforce problematic behaviors, clinicians can design interventions to weaken these reinforcements and replace maladaptive behaviors with healthier alternatives.

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der
Ob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D) is a mental health condition characterized by recurrent obsessions, compulsions, or both, which consume significant time and interfere with daily functioning. Obsessions involve persistent, intrusive, and unwanted thoughts, images, or urges that evoke anxiety. Common examples include irrational fears of contamination or harm.
